About POP MART
Founded in 2010, POP MART is a market-leading entertainment company and a global champion of designer toy culture. Through global artist development, IP operations, and designer toy culture evangelism, we have built an integrated platform covering the entire designer toy value chain. Besides our original and iconic IPs such as Molly, Hirono, Skullpanda, and LABUBU, POP MART collaborates with top-tier toys and lifestyle brands including Disney, Universal Studios, and Sanrio to create collectible art toys featuring their iconic characters.
In the UK, POP MART operates seven stores in London and Midlands, and over six Robo Shops (vending machines for POP MART products). With our ambitious growth plan, we continue to expand our retail network by opening new stores in London and nationwide.

The Role and Candidate
The Merchandising Coordinator will play a crucial role in optimising POP MART's inventory management and logistics operations across the UK market. Reporting to the Merchandising Supervisor, this dynamic position is responsible for managing merchandise transfers, maintaining warehouse systems, and conducting data analysis to support the company's efficient retail operations. The successful candidate will work collaboratively with various departments to ensure smooth inventory flow, accurate data management, and timely reporting, contributing significantly to POP MART's operational excellence and growth objectives.
Responsibilities
- Manage merchandise transfers and daily operations between multiple stores and warehouses
- Maintain warehouse systems and internal data systems to ensure accuracy and efficiency
- Facilitate communication between retail, warehouse, and headquarters to ensure smooth operations
- Handle customs clearance and process logistics invoices for reimbursement
- Participate in quarterly and annual inventory counts, ensuring proper stock management
- Conduct data analysis and provide regular reports or summaries to support decision-making
- Handle operational emergencies and solve problems quickly and effectively
- Collaborate with the merchandise team to ensure timely delivery of projects and tasks
- Complete other tasks assigned according to project needs
